Conquer Burnout: Lifehacks for Managing Messaging and Rejections

Navigating modern dating can feel exhausting. Endless messaging leads to fatigue and discouragement. The expectation to respond instantly can create significant stress, especially when faced with repeated rejections. Understanding how to manage this emotional toll is vital for maintaining your enthusiasm in seeking meaningful connections. Here’s how to avoid burnout from endless messaging and rejections, using practical lifehacks tailored specifically for single men.

Set Boundaries for Messaging

It’s crucial to limit the time spent engaged in conversations. Whether you’re chatting on Tinder, Bumble, or any other platform, setting boundaries helps protect your time and emotional well-being.

Tips to Manage Your Messaging Time

  • Schedule Check-In Times: Designate specific blocks of time for checking messages and replying. For instance, you might decide to check your messages for 15 minutes in the mornings and 15 minutes in the evenings to stay focused.
  • Use Do Not Disturb Modes: Silence notifications during your personal time to reduce distractions and avoid feeling overwhelmed.
  • Limit New Matches: Focus on quality over quantity by restricting new conversations to a manageable number, such as only engaging with two new matches per week.

Setting these boundaries fosters more thoughtful conversations and reduces the stress of constant notifications.

Approach Rejections with a Positive Mindset

Rejection happens in dating; learning from it can help you maintain a healthier outlook. Instead of viewing rejections as personal failures, consider them opportunities to refine your approach and self-awareness.

Strategies to Reframe Rejections

  • Practice Self-Compassion: Self-compassion means treating yourself with kindness during tough times. You can practice this by keeping a “win list”-a collection of compliments or positive interactions that you can review when you feel low.
  • Seek Feedback: If appropriate, ask for honest feedback from your matches to improve your approach for future conversations.
  • Focus on Growth: Use rejections as a chance to learn, not just about others but about what you truly want in a partner.

This mindset shift can lessen the sting of rejections and help you move forward more easily.

Engage Mindfully with Matches

When engaging with potential matches, being fully present can elevate the quality of your interactions. Instead of mindlessly scrolling through conversations, invest genuine interest in each match.

How to Be Present in Conversations

  • Ask Open-Ended Questions: Encourage deeper discussions by asking questions that can’t be answered with just a “yes” or “no.” This helps you connect better.
  • Share Personal Stories: Relating personal anecdotes can strengthen the connection and make you feel more invested in the conversation.
  • Practice Active Listening: Active listening means truly focusing on what the other person is saying without planning your reply while they speak. To practice this, you can summarize what your match says before responding to ensure understanding.

This engagement will make the experience more fulfilling and less draining.

Incorporate Self-Care into Your Routine

Balancing the demands of dating with personal well-being is essential to avoiding burnout. Prioritizing self-care boosts emotional resilience during dating challenges.

Effective Self-Care Practices

  • Stay Active: Engage in activities tailored to reducing stress, like yoga or a mindful walk, where you can consciously release tension associated with dating.
  • Connect with Friends: Spend quality time with friends who can offer support and remind you of your worth outside the dating landscape.
  • Explore New Hobbies: Delve into activities you love to help take your mind off any frustrations, making room for positivity in your day.

By prioritizing self-care, you ensure that your well-being isn’t sacrificed in the pursuit of romantic connections.
